Why is Cash App taking money without permission?

You need to understand why Cash App is deducting money from your account without your permission to help resolve the issue. Cash App charges its users for certain transactions, especially those made using a business account.

However, they always notify you of the fees associated with each transaction. Let’s examine some of the reasons for Cash App taking money without permission:

1. Unauthorized transactions

In most cases, unauthorized transactions are the primary reason why Cash App may deduct money from your account without your permission.

If you accidentally reveal your Cash App username and password to a third party, and the person uses your details to transfer funds to another account, your money will continue to disappear until you change your login details. So, if you suspect that your Cash App account has been hacked and that the charges are strange, you want to contact Cash App immediately.

2. Automatic or recurring bill payments

If you have set up automatic bill payment on Cash App, it is possible that the app may deduct funds from your account without your knowledge.

Before concluding that Cash App is taking money without permission, check to see if you have authorized auto-renewal of bill payments. Users who use Cash App to pay their bills may not receive notifications when their bills have been paid. It can take up to 10 days for Cash App to receive the refund.

3. Pending payments

It’s possible for Cash App to complete a pending payment or transfer without your consent, which may result in you thinking that money is missing from your account. This can happen if you forget about a transaction or fail to cancel it before it is completed by the app.

In such a scenario, it’s essential to check your transaction history on Cash App to identify any pending payments or transfers that you may have forgotten about. This way, you can avoid any misunderstandings and ensure that your account is up-to-date.

While this isn’t an exhaustive list, bear in mind that these are some of the most common reasons why Cash App may take money from your account without your permission.

Additionally, if you are using a business account or withdrawing money from an ATM, fees will be applied. As I mentioned earlier, Cash App is not entirely free.

What to do if Cash App is taking money without permission?

When you notice that your Cash App taking money without permission, irrespective of what the problem might be, the first thing is to cancel all pending transactions on your Cash App

Also, if you misplaced your Cash Card, you can report it stolen. According to Cash App, follow the steps below:

  • Tap the Cash Card tab on your Cash App home screen.
  • Tap the image of your Cash Card
  • Select Problem With Card
  • Tap Card Stolen
  • Verify with your PIN or Touch ID. That’s all.

How to cancel pending transactions on your Cash App

If you want to cancel a pending Cash App transaction, the process is fairly simple. However, you need to act fast, as there is only a small window of time in which you can cancel a transaction before it is processed. Here’s how to do it:

1. Open the Cash App on your mobile device

Make sure that you have the most up-to-date version of the Cash App installed on your mobile device.

2. Go to the Activity tab

On the Cash App home screen, click on the “Activity” tab at the bottom of the screen. This will take you to a list of your recent transactions.

3. Find the transaction you want to cancel

Scroll down the list until you find the pending transaction that you want to cancel.

4. Click on the transaction(s)

Tap on the transaction to open it and view the details.

5. Look for the ‘Cancel’ button

If the transaction is still pending, you should see a “Cancel” button located underneath the transaction details.

6. Confirm the cancellation

Tap on the “Cancel” button and confirm that you want to cancel the transaction.

7. Check your Cash App balance

Once the cancellation is complete, the funds should be returned to your Cash App balance immediately. You can check your balance by going back to the Cash App home screen and looking at the top of the screen.

Note: Cash App transactions typically go through several phases once they are processed. These phases include:

  1. Pending: During this phase, the transaction is waiting to be confirmed by the recipient or the network.
  2. Processing: Once the transaction has been confirmed, it enters the processing phase. This is when the transaction is being processed and the money is being moved from one account to another.
  3. Completed: Once the processing phase is complete, the transaction is marked as completed. At this point, the recipient should have received the money.
  4. Failed: If the transaction is not successful for any reason, it may be marked as failed. This could happen if there was an issue with the payment method or if the recipient’s account information was incorrect.

With these in mind, understand that the status of a transaction will determine if it can be successfully canceled or not.

Possible reasons for unauthorized Cash App transactions

Now, having canceled all pending transactions, the next step is to try to figure out what happened. And as previously mentioned, there are a plethora of reasons why there might be unauthorized transactions on your bank account. Let’s deal with the three most logical reasons why this might be happening to you.

 

1. Account has been hacked

Unfortunately, it is not uncommon for scammers to target Cash App users. Here are some steps you can take if you believe that you have been scammed:

a. Contact Cash App Support

If you suspect that you have been scammed, the first step is to contact Cash App support immediately. You can do this by navigating to the “Support” section of the app and selecting “Something Else”. From there, you can explain the situation to the support team and ask them to investigate the suspicious transactions.

b. Report the scam to the authorities

Report any scam to the authorities citing it as a reason for Cash App taking money without permission. You can contact the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) or your local law enforcement agency to report the scam.

c. Change your Cash App password

To prevent further unauthorized transactions, it is important to change your Cash App password as soon as possible. You can do this by going to the “Account & Settings” section of the app and selecting “Security”. From there, you can change your password and enable two-factor authentication for added security.

2. Mistake from your end

Your Cash App taking money without permission could be due to a mistake on your end. Here are some common mistakes that can lead to unauthorized transactions:

  • Accidentally sending money to the wrong person
  • Sharing your account details with someone who then makes unauthorized transactions
  • Allowing someone to use your phone or device to access your Cash App account

Here’s what to do if you believe that the transactions were as a result of mistake(s) from your end:

a. Check your transaction history

The first step is to check your transaction history to see if there are any unauthorized transactions. You can do this by navigating to the “Activity” section of the app.

b. Contact the recipient

If you have accidentally sent money to the wrong person, it is important to contact the recipient immediately and request a refund. You can do this by selecting the transaction in your activity feed and selecting “Request Refund”. You can also contact the recipient directly to request a refund.

c. Enable security features

To prevent future unauthorized transactions, it is important to enable security features such as two-factor authentication and a Cash PIN. You can do this by navigating to the “Account & Settings” section of the app.

3. Normal problems

In some cases, Cash App may be taking money without permission due to technical issues. You can follow some of these tips to solve your problem if you are experiencing normal problems with Cash App:

a. Check for updates

Make sure that you have the latest version of the Cash App installed on your device. You can check for updates in the App Store or Google Play Store.

b. Contact Cash App support

If you are experiencing technical issues or errors, it is important to contact Cash App support. You can do this by navigating to the “Support” section of the app and selecting “Something Else”. From there, you can explain the issue to the support team and request assistance.

c. Monitor your account

To prevent further unauthorized transactions, it is important to monitor your Cash App account regularly. Check your transaction history and account balance regularly to ensure that there are no unauthorized transactions.

How to keep your Cash App account safe

As previously mentioned, one of the main reasons why people lose money on Cash App is due to scams. Here are a few tips to keep you safe:

1. Beware of phishing attempts

Scammers may send you a link that looks legitimate but redirects you to a fake Cash App login page. Once you enter your login credentials, the scammer can access your account and make unauthorized transactions. To avoid falling victim to scams, it’s crucial to be cautious when clicking on links or entering your login information.

Never share your login credentials with anyone, including friends or family.

2. Enable two-factor authentication

This security feature will add an extra layer of security to your account.

3. Never hesitate to report suspicious activities

Report any suspicious activity or messages to Cash App’s support team immediately.

4. Keep your account information up-to-date

Another way to prevent unauthorized transactions on Cash App is to keep your account information up-to-date. This includes your email address, phone number, and payment card information. If any of this information changes, update it in your Cash App account immediately.

5. Use your Cash App card with care

Cash App offers a debit card that you can use to make purchases or withdraw cash. While it’s a convenient feature, it’s important to use it wisely to avoid unintended money loss. Here are a few precautions to keep in mind when using your Cash App card:

  1. Only use your Cash App card at trusted merchants and ATMs.
  2. Set up alerts to notify you of any transactions made with your card.
  3. Don’t share your card information with anyone, even if they claim to be a Cash App representative.

Can I prevent unauthorized transactions on Cash App by disabling my account?

While disabling your Cash App account will prevent all transactions, including unauthorized ones. You must keep in mind that disabling your Cash App account is permanent, and you will not be able to access any of your account information or transaction history after it is disabled.

Therefore, ensure that you have resolved any outstanding issues, such as unauthorized transactions, before disabling your account.

Will Cash App refund stolen money?

Cash App has a refund policy in place for unauthorized transactions, but it’s essential to understand the terms and conditions. In most cases, you have up to 60 days to dispute the transaction, and Cash App will investigate the issue.

In essence, if the company finds that the transaction was unauthorized, they will refund your money. However, if you wait too long to dispute the transaction, Cash App may not be able to recover or refund your money.

FAQs

How long does it take to get a refund for unauthorized transactions on Cash App?

While there isn’t much information out there on this, it’s worth noting that generally, refunds for unauthorized transactions on Cash App may take about 3-10 business days to process. If you haven’t received a refund within that time frame, then you may contact Cash App support.

Can I dispute Cash App transactions through my bank?

You can dispute Cash App transactions through your bank if you believe they were unauthorized. But its important to keep in mind that Cash App has its own dispute resolution process, so it’s best to contact Cash App support first.

Does Cash App have any fraud protection?

Cash App has some fraud protection measures in place, such as fraud detection algorithms and the ability to freeze accounts if suspicious activity is detected.
